Bengal Chief Secretary Alapan Bandyopadhyay - controversially recalled by the centre last week after a row between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ee - is unlikely to report to Delhi as ordered
Alapan Bandyopadhyay, a 1987-batch IAS officer of the West Bengal cadre, was scheduled to retire on May 31 after completion of 60 years of age. However, he was granted a three-month extension following a nod from the Centre to work on Covid management.
